Weald Deanery is part of the Diocese of Canterbury and is situated in the Weald of Kent - the Garden of England.

Logo of the Cranbrook Deanery

The Weald Deanery comprises the Churches of:-

St. Dunstan's Church, Cranbrook

St. Mary the Virgin's Church, Goudhurst with Christ Church, KILNDOWN

St. Laurence's Church, Hawkhurst

St. Peter and St. Paul's Church, Headcorn

St. Michael and All Angels Church, Marden

Trinity Church, Sissinghurst with St. Mary's Church, Frittenden

All Saint's Church, Staplehurst

The Area Dean is The Reverend Canon Gill Calver, Rector of All Saints Staplehurst and Chaplain to Her Majesty the Queen.

The Deanery Synod comprises members of the clergy of the constituent parishes, and lay members elected at their Annual Parochial Church Meeting to serve for 3 years. The Lay Chair is Mrs. Val Wallis, MBE. The Deanery is also represented at the Diocesan Synod.

The Deanery Synod normally meets 3 times a year, rotating round the parishes, in February, June and October, with additional meetings if there is a need.
